Average Marriage and Family Therapists Salary in North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area

The average salary for a Marriage and Family Therapists in North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area is $75,460. This compensation is in line with national standards, reflecting a balanced and stable local job market. Notably, North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area is a key hub for this profession, with a job concentration 2.1x higher than average.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$75,460 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 29.9%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$112,080.
  • Outlook: The current demand for Marriage and Family Therapistss is stable, with a local workforce of approximately 90 professionals. This role remains a specialized component of the broader North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area economy.

Marriage and Family Therapists Salary Distribution in North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area

The earning potential for Marriage and Family Therapistss in North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area varies significantly by experience level. The salary gap is relatively narrow, suggesting consistent and predictable earnings from entry-level to senior positions. Entry-level roles (10th percentile) typically start around $45,690, while highly experienced professionals can command wages upwards of $112,080.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does a Marriage and Family Therapists make in North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area?

The median annual salary for a Marriage and Family Therapists in North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area is $75,460. This typically ranges from $45,690 for entry-level positions to $112,080 for top-level roles.

How does the salary compare to the national average?

The average salary for this role in North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area is 5.4% higher than the national median of $71,600.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 90 employees in the North Valley-Northern Mountains Region of California nonmetropolitan area area with a job density of 0.898 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
